In Nashik, India, Mateen Patel, a corporator from the All India Majlis-e-Ittehad-ul-Muslimeen (AIMIM) party, has been booked for allegedly providing shelter to Nida Khan, an accused in a sexual exploitation case linked to Tata Consultancy Services (TCS). Khan, who had been evading arrest for 42 days, was apprehended after police received tips about her whereabouts in Sambhajinagar. Patel reportedly offered a house in Naregaon, where Khan lived with her family, and provided them food. He has been charged under section 238 of the Bombay Police Act for allegedly aiding in the disappearance of evidence. The case has drawn political scrutiny, with Maharashtra's Chief Minister Devendra Fadnavis asserting that Patel's involvement indicates organized support for Khan. The situation has led to a public dispute between AIMIM and Shiv Sena leaders regarding the allegations against AIMIM members. As the investigation continues, police are expected to identify others who may have assisted Khan during her time on the run.
